<p>Before discussing the popular <strong>gluten-free diet</strong>, it is important to know about gluten. Gluten is a group of proteins found in certain grains, such as wheat, rye and barley. It helps food maintain its shape by providing elasticity and moisture. It also allows the bread to rise and provides a chewy texture.</p> <p>Going gluten-free means avoiding these grains. This diet is essential for most people with gluten allergies or celiac disease, a condition that causes intestinal damage when gluten is consumed.</p> <p>The most difficult step to follow on this diet is bidding farewell to bread. But dont worry, many grocery stores and supermarkets now carry gluten-free products, including an assortment of breads. These are often made with rice or potato flour instead of wheat products. Just check the label to make sure it says 100% gluten-free.</p> <p>If youre planning to go gluten-free, here are some healthy food options for you.</p> <h3><strong>Corn and rice cereals</strong></h3> <p>Traditional breakfast cereals are another casualty for people on a <a href=https://www.editorji.com/story/gluten-free-alternatives-grains-you-can-include-in-your-diet-1600142825168 target=_blank>gluten-free diet</a>. Corn and rice-based cereals are good breakfast alternatives, but its crucial to read labels carefully, as some may also contain malt.</p> <h3><strong>A new twist on pasta</strong></h3> <p>Its true, no matter what its shape or name, most pasta is made out of wheat. So youll need to avoid regular spaghetti, macaroni, shells and spirals when youre on a gluten-free diet. Instead, look for pasta made from rice, corn or quinoa.</p> <h3><strong>Go for lean meat</strong></h3> <p>You dont need to hide the succulent charms of fresh chicken, fish and meat under a loaf of bread. Go for lean meat without any additives and youll be eating right for a gluten-free diet. Do keep in mind that hot dogs and deli meats are processed, so check the ingredients for additives that might contain gluten.</p> <h3><strong>Gluten-free cookies and cakes</strong></h3> <p>While a gluten-free diet wont contain most traditional cakes, pies, cookies and other celebratory treats which are loaded with <a href=https://www.editorji.com/story/expert-advice-do-we-need-to-avoid-eating-wheat-1597745382949 target=_blank>wheat</a> flour, there are still lots of ways to satisfy your sweet tooth. Marshmallows, gumdrops, plain hard candies are all usually gluten-free.
